Welcome to those of you joining from my recent presentations in Panhandle, Waco, and Clovis.<\/p>\n<p>Here are some of the ag law stories in the news recently:<\/p>\n<p>*<strong>California voters pass new\u00a0animal welfare law.<\/strong>\u00a0 Earlier this month, California voters passed\u00a0Proposition 12,\u00a0requiring that all eggs sold in California must come from cage-free hens by 2022.\u00a0 The new law will also impose restrictions on the sale of veal and pork where certain production practices are not met.\u00a0 For veal, calves must have at least 43 square feet of floor space by 2020, and breeding pigs must be given at least 24 square foot of floor space by 2022.\u00a0 For hens, the law requires 1 square foot of floor space by 2020, with cage-free being required by 2022.\u00a0 This law will have impacts beyond California&#8217;s borders, as producers in other states wishing to sell products in California will be required to comply as well.\u00a0 [Read article <a href=\"https:\/\/www.morningagclips.com\/california-makes-cage-free-hens-a-state-law\/\">here<\/a>.]\u00a0 Keep in mind, the prior California law that required certain size limitations for hens laying any eggs to be sold in California is currently facing challenge by numerous states in the US Supreme Court.\u00a0 [Read prior blog post<a href=\"https:\/\/agrilife.org\/texasaglaw\/2018\/01\/15\/egg-production-practices-subject-supreme-court-lawsuits\/\"> here<\/a>.]<\/p>\n<div id=\"attachment_7056\" style=\"width: 650px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-7056\" class=\"wp-image-7056 size-large\" src=\"https:\/\/agrilife.org\/texasaglaw\/files\/2018\/11\/mai-moeslund-757971-unsplash-1024x687.jpg\" alt=\"\" width=\"640\" height=\"429\" srcset=\"https:\/\/agrilife.org\/texasaglaw\/files\/2018\/11\/mai-moeslund-757971-unsplash-1024x687.jpg 1024w, https:\/\/agrilife.org\/texasaglaw\/files\/2018\/11\/mai-moeslund-757971-unsplash-300x201.jpg 300w, https:\/\/agrilife.org\/texasaglaw\/files\/2018\/11\/mai-moeslund-757971-unsplash-768x516.jpg 768w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 640px) 100vw, 640px\" \/><p id=\"caption-attachment-7056\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Photo by Mai Moeslund on Unsplash<\/p><\/div>\n<p><strong>*Montana case raises interesting question about ownership of fossils.<\/strong>\u00a0 One of my readers sent me a really interesting case that raised the following question:\u00a0 Are fossils owned by the surface owner, or the mineral owner?\u00a0 This case arose when valuable fossils were found on a\u00a0ranch in Montana.\u00a0 That\u00a0US Court of Appeals for the Ninth Circuit\u00a0found that dinosaur fossils were &#8220;minerals&#8221; under the terms of the deed, and thus, belonged to the mineral owner.\u00a0 This\u00a0decision was made based on a Texas case that looked at whether the substance at issue\u00a0was &#8220;rare and exceptional in character or possessed a peculiar property giving it special value.&#8221;\u00a0 The dissenting judge would have found the fossils to be owned by the surface owner because the &#8220;ordinary and natural meaning test&#8221; would find fossils not to be a mineral.\u00a0 I did a quick search and found no published opinions addressing this issue here in Texas, but\u00a0it is interesting that it was the approach from a Texas case that led the Ninth Circuit to this decision.\u00a0 We&#8217;ll see if this comes up here one day.\u00a0 [<a href=\"https:\/\/agrilife.org\/texasaglaw\/files\/2018\/11\/Read-Opinion-here.pdf\">Read Opinion here<\/a>.]<\/p>\n<p><strong>* Farm Succession Planning Newsletter Series.<\/strong>\u00a0 The Hallock &amp;
